diff options
author | Lucien Gentis <lgentis@apache.org> | 2021-06-05 17:05:31 +0200 |
---|---|---|
committer | Lucien Gentis <lgentis@apache.org> | 2021-06-05 17:05:31 +0200 |
commit | 303010734b5ac4d3579133f8e82ededadcc646a9 (patch) | |
tree | f8c300d59353e31108c21e388b6b295f57ec1a8f /docs/manual | |
parent | Add mapping = servlet / encoded (diff) | |
download | apache2-303010734b5ac4d3579133f8e82ededadcc646a9.tar.xz apache2-303010734b5ac4d3579133f8e82ededadcc646a9.zip |
fr doc XML files updates.
git-svn-id: https://svn.apache.org/repos/asf/httpd/httpd/trunk@1890505 13f79535-47bb-0310-9956-ffa450edef68
Diffstat (limited to 'docs/manual')
-rw-r--r-- | docs/manual/mod/core.xml.fr | 61 | ||||
-rw-r--r-- | docs/manual/mod/mod_proxy.xml.fr | 9 |
2 files changed, 42 insertions, 28 deletions
diff --git a/docs/manual/mod/core.xml.fr b/docs/manual/mod/core.xml.fr index 10208d77c2..4407cdd609 100644 --- a/docs/manual/mod/core.xml.fr +++ b/docs/manual/mod/core.xml.fr @@ -1,7 +1,7 @@ <?xml version="1.0" encoding="UTF-8" ?> <!DOCTYPE modulesynopsis SYSTEM "../style/modulesynopsis.dtd"> <?xml-stylesheet type="text/xsl" href="../style/manual.fr.xsl"?> -<!-- English Revision: 1885464 --> +<!-- English Revision: 1890424 --> <!-- French translation : Lucien GENTIS --> <!-- Reviewed by : Vincent Deffontaines --> @@ -3429,19 +3429,18 @@ host</context> </Location> </highlight> - <note><title>Note à propos du slash (/)</title> - <p>La signification du caractère slash dépend de l'endroit où il - se trouve dans l'URL. Les utilisateurs peuvent être habitués à - son comportement dans le système de fichiers où plusieurs slashes - successifs sont souvent réduits à un slash unique (en d'autres - termes, <code>/home///foo</code> est identique à - <code>/home/foo</code>). Dans l'espace de nommage des URLs, ce - n'est cependant pas toujours le cas. Pour la directive <directive - type="section" module="core">LocationMatch</directive> et la - version avec expressions rationnelles de la directive <directive - type="section">Location</directive>, vous devez spécifier - explicitement les slashes multiples si telle est votre - intention.</p> + <note><title>Note à propos du slash (/)</title> <p>La signification du + caractère slash dépend de l'endroit où il se trouve dans l'URL. Les + utilisateurs peuvent être habitués à son comportement dans le système de + fichiers où plusieurs slashes successifs sont souvent réduits à un slash + unique (en d'autres termes, <code>/home///foo</code> est identique à + <code>/home/foo</code>). Dans l'espace de nommage des URLs, ce n'est + cependant pas toujours vrai si la directive <directive + module="core">MergeSlashes</directive> a été définie à "OFF". Pour la + directive <directive type="section" module="core">LocationMatch</directive> + et la version avec expressions rationnelles de la directive <directive + type="section">Location</directive>, vous devez spécifier explicitement les + slashes multiples si les slashes ne sont pas fusionnés.</p> <p>Par exemple, <code><LocationMatch "^/abc"></code> va correspondre à l'URL <code>/abc</code> mais pas à l'URL <code> @@ -3516,16 +3515,18 @@ host</context> </LocationMatch> </highlight> - <note><title>Note à propos du slash '/'</title> - <p>La signification du caractère slash '/' dépend de l'endroit où il - apparaît dans une URL. Les utilisateurs sont habitués à voir de multiples - slashes adjacents réduits à un seul au sein du système de fichiers (par - exemple, <code>/home///foo</code> est équivalent à - <code>/home/foo</code>). Ce n'est n'est cependant pas toujours le cas au - sein des URLs. En effet, si vous souhaitez spécifier plusieurs slashes, - vous devez le faire explicitement au sein de la directive <directive - type="section" module="core">LocationMatch</directive> et de la version - regex de la directive <directive type="section">Location</directive>.</p> + <note><title>Note à propos du slash '/'</title> <p>La signification du + caractère slash '/' dépend de l'endroit où il apparaît dans une URL. Les + utilisateurs sont habitués à voir de multiples slashes adjacents réduits à + un seul au sein du système de fichiers (par exemple, + <code>/home///foo</code> est équivalent à <code>/home/foo</code>). Ce n'est + n'est cependant pas toujours vrai au sein des URLs si la directive + <directive module="core">MergeSlashes</directive> a été définie à "OFF". En + effet, si vous souhaitez spécifier plusieurs slashes, vous devez le faire + explicitement au sein de la directive <directive type="section" + module="core">LocationMatch</directive> et de la version regex de la + directive <directive type="section">Location</directive>, si les slashes ne + sont pas fusionnés.</p> <p>Par exemple, <code><LocationMatch "^/abc"></code> correspondra à l'URL <code>/abc</code>, mais pas à l'URL <code>//abc</code>. La directive @@ -5835,12 +5836,18 @@ dernière. préférable de conserver ces slashes multiples et consécutifs car ils peuvent avoir une signification dans le cas des URLs gérées différemment, par exemple par CGI ou par un serveur mandataire. Il convient alors de définir - <directive>MergeSlashes</directive> à <em>OFF</em>. Dans ces types de - configuration, les expressions rationnelles utilisées dans le + <directive>MergeSlashes</directive> à <em>OFF</em> pour conserver les + slashes multiples consécutifs, ce qui correspond au comportement + traditionnel.</p> + <p> + Lorsque cette directive est définie à "OFF", les expressions rationnelles utilisées dans le fichier de configuration pour effectuer une comparaison de la partie chemin de l'URL ((<directive>LocationMatch</directive>, <directive>RewriteRule</directive>, ...) doivent en effet tenir compte de la - présence éventuelle de slashes multiples et consécutifs.</p> + présence éventuelle de slashes multiples et consécutifs. Les sections + <directive>Location</directive> à base d'expressions non rationnelles + correspondent toujours à des URLs avec slashes fusionnés et ne peuvent pas + tenir compte des slashes multiples.</p> </usage> </directivesynopsis> diff --git a/docs/manual/mod/mod_proxy.xml.fr b/docs/manual/mod/mod_proxy.xml.fr index a2929e9ba8..4ced122c21 100644 --- a/docs/manual/mod/mod_proxy.xml.fr +++ b/docs/manual/mod/mod_proxy.xml.fr @@ -1,7 +1,7 @@ <?xml version="1.0" encoding="UTF-8" ?> <!DOCTYPE modulesynopsis SYSTEM "../style/modulesynopsis.dtd"> <?xml-stylesheet type="text/xsl" href="../style/manual.fr.xsl"?> -<!-- English Revision: 1883045 --> +<!-- English Revision: 1890477 --> <!-- French translation : Lucien GENTIS --> <!-- Reviewed by : Vincent Deffontaines --> @@ -1462,6 +1462,13 @@ ProxyPass "/mirror/foo/i" "!" l'en-tête Upgrade. Voir la documentation de ce module pour plus de détails.</p> </td></tr> + <tr><td>mapping</td> + <td>-</td> + <td><p>Mappage pour traiter l'<var>url</var> avant de choisir un + Worker/Balancer. 'servlet' mappe comme un conteneur de servlet + (comme jk_servlet_normalize), à utiliser avec Apache Tomcat par exemple. + 'encoded' mappe en mode chiffré.</p> + </td></tr> </table> |